CPC80114 Graduate Certificate in Fire Systems Design Management
CPC80114
Graduate Certificate in Fire Systems Design Management
MODIFICATION HISTORY
Release
Comments
1
This version first released with CPC Construction, Plumbing and
Services Training Package Version 1.
Replaces superseded equivalent CPC70109 Vocational Graduate
Certificate in Fire Systems Design Management from CPC08
Construction, Plumbing and Services Training Package Version 9.
QUALIFICATION
DESCRIPTION
This qualification reflects the role of senior managers in the fire
systems design sector who perform wide-ranging tasks while also
exercising in-depth technical skills and knowledge, particularly in the
area of special hazard fire suppression and detection systems.
No licensing, legislative, regulatory, accreditation or certification
requirements apply to this qualification at the time of endorsement.
ENTRY
REQUIREMENTS
There are no entry requirements for this qualification.
PACKAGING
RULES
To achieve this qualification, competency must be demonstrated in
four units drawn from the units below.
